What is Cloud Computing?
Cloud computing can be explained simply as a model of delivering computing services, such as servers, storage, databases, networking, software, and analytics, via the internet, more popularly known as “the cloud.” Businesses can get such resources according to their requirements from cloud service providers without having to own and maintain physical data centers and servers and pay only as per the resources used.

Benefits of Cloud Computing
Cost Efficiency: The role of cloud computing is to remove the capital expenditure associated with buying hardware and software, setting up and running on-site data centers, and managing the infrastructure. Substantial cost savings are inherent therein.

Scalability: Cloud solutions allow flexibility in scaling resources up or down, depending on demand. This happens to be highly useful for firms that have variable workloads.

Accessibility: Cloud services are accessible from any part of the world where there is an internet connection. This allows for telecommuting and collaboration on projects by employees spread across different geographical locations.

Disaster Recovery/Business Continuity: Cloud computing companies provide a very robust backup and recovery in case of disaster. Thus, data is safe and can be restored from the backup site with minimal delay in case of any disaster.

Automatic Updates: The cloud service providers keep updating their services with the latest technology, features, and security patches, easing pressure on the IT departments.

Better Security: The best cloud providers invest enormously in security technologies and practices; most of the time, they deliver security out of reach for most private enterprises.

Types of Cloud Computing Solutions
Infrastructure as a Service (IaaS): It provides virtualized computing resources via the internet. One can rent virtual machines, storage, and networks, scaling as necessary. AWS, Microsoft Azure, and GCP are examples.

PaaS — It is responsible for providing the developer with a platform upon which the application can be built, deployed, and managed, without regard to the underlying infrastructure. Examples include AWS Elastic Beanstalk, Google App Engine, and Microsoft Azure App Services.

Well, SaaS stands for “Software as a Service,” which refers to a model of delivering software applications over the internet on a subscription basis. It gives the opportunity to access the application from a web browser without having to install or maintain the applications. Popular SaaS solutions include Google Workspace, Microsoft 365, and Salesforce.

Function as a Service: It is also known as serverless computing because FaaS lets the developer execute code in response to events without managing servers. This model provides excellent scalability and cost-effectiveness for intermittent workloads. AWS Lambda, Azure Functions, Google Cloud Functions are examples.

Choosing the correct solution to cloud computing will have the business consider a number of factors:

Business Requirements: Determine the exact needs and objectives of the business. A business looking for an affordable way of hosting websites can choose IaaS, and one that wants to collaborate on a tank can decide on SaaS.

Compliance and Security: Make sure that the cloud provider abides by the industry standards and regulations. Examine how far existing security measures are already put in place to offer protection for sensitive information.

Performance and Reliability: Assess the performance and uptimes guaranteed by the cloud provider. Reliable service with as little downtime as possible is rich in business continuity.

Cost: Compare their pricing models. Consider the TCO, including those ‘hidden’ costs, such as data transfer fees or additional technical support fees.

Integration and Compatibility: Ensure that this cloud solution will integrate well with existing systems and workflows. Evidently, some compatibility tools or services from other businesses will help in running the operations smoothly.

Future Trends in Cloud Computing
Bright is the future of computing in the cloud, and full of various trends that are shaping the landscape. First, there is increased hybrid and multi-cloud strategy adoption as businesses try to leverage the strengths of different cloud providers without being locked in by any single vendor.

Edge Computing: This refers to the processing of data closer to source, hence reducing latency and bandwidth usage, therefore boosting performance for Cloud applications.

Integrate AI and Machine Learning: Cloud platforms are increasingly integrating AI and machine learning, allowing businesses to work on advanced analytics centrally and automate tasks.

More Sophisticated Security Controls: As cyber threats continue to evolve, cloud providers invest in advanced security technologies like AI-driven threat detection and zero-trust architecture.

Sustainability Posture: Cloud providers will focus on a sustainability posture wherein data centers are optimized for efficient energy use and investment in renewable energy sources.
